New Transportation Barriers Installed: Walt Disney World has implemented new transportation barriers impacting access to the Magic Kingdom and Monorail Resort Area hotels, especially affecting guests parking at the Transportation & Ticket Center. Guests may face restrictions when resort hopping between the Magic Kingdom and nearby resorts. [4]

Major Transformation at Disney's Hollywood Studios: A significant transformation is set for Disney's Hollywood Studios with a new destination in the Animation Courtyard, opening on September 14. This indoor venue will celebrate Disney animation with various experiences. [2]

Dockside Diner Refurbishment: Dockside Diner at Disney’s Hollywood Studios is undergoing refurbishment but remains open for dining, allowing guests to enjoy meals during the Echo Lake construction. [7]

Closure of Original Theme Park Entrance: Disneyland Resort has closed the original theme park entrance area, including the demolition of four ticket booths. Guests are encouraged to visit alternate locations such as the Emporium and other shops along Main Street, U.S.A. [3]

Oogie Boogie Bash Park Hopper Restriction: On nights of the Oogie Boogie Bash, access to Disney California Adventure is restricted once the party begins, but daytime access for regular guests is unaffected. This impacts guests planning to use Park Hopper tickets. [6]
